Most people start freelancing by doing many different types of tasks for anyone who is willing to pay them. This is what we call being a generalist, but it often leads to low pay and too much stress. I believe that picking one specific area and becoming an expert is the only way to charge much higher rates. It takes time to build a reputation in just one niche so others know your name. How do you transition from being a generalist freelancer to a recognized specialist?